3. The Six-Step Framework for a Profitable Apprenticeship
Seth doesn’t just tell you to start an apprenticeship—he gives you the exact playbook:
- Identify Value Drivers: Why are you launching an apprenticeship? Is it to fill talent gaps, increase profitability, or win contracts?
- Decide on Registered vs. Unregistered Apprenticeships: Do you need government certification, or can you move faster without it?
- Design Coursework and On-the-Job Training: What skills do you need to teach, and how will you integrate learning into daily work?
- Create a Sustainable Wage Structure: Pay apprentices fairly, but make sure it aligns with your business model.
- Budget for Growth: Apprenticeships should be cost-effective. He teaches you how to build a system that pays for itself.
- Recruit, Train, and Retain: The best part? Once you get this running, it scales effortlessly.
4. Apprenticeships Help You Win More Business
This is where my entrepreneurial brain lit up. Seth breaks down how companies that integrate apprenticeships into their hiring process gain access to bigger contracts, government funding, and new business opportunities.
For example, federal programs like the Inflation Reduction Act and CHIPS and Science Act favor businesses with apprenticeship models. If you run a service-based or contracting business, this could be a game-changer.
